10285421205561531811868531
Odd
10285421205561531811868531 is odd
Previous odd number is 10285421205561531811868529
Next odd number is 10285421205561531811868533
Cubed
1088093571520014500514664941514685662467100467691487096294656197182921165291
Squared
Binary
1000 1000 0010 0000 0101 1100 1101 0000 0001 0011 1001 0010 0011 0010 1100 1011 0101 1010 1111 0111 0011